The Continuously Shooting Blunderbuss, also known as "Lianzhu Huochong" (连珠火铳), was a kind of breech-loading, smooth-bore, single-shot flintlock, invented by Dai Zi (戴梓), a firearms expert in the early Qing Dynasty, in the thirteenth year of Kangxi (1674).
